In the original 42-litre mixture, Chemical A and B are in a 4:3 ratio, so out of 7 total parts, A makes up \(\dfrac{4}{7} \times 42 = 24\) litres and B makes up \(\dfrac{3}{7} \times 42 = 18\) litres.
After adding 12 more litres of B, the new amount of B becomes \(18+12=30\) litres, while A stays at 24 litres.
The new ratio A:B is \(24:30\), which simplifies down to \(4:5\), matching option 1.
